PILEUPS
Ingredients:
baked chicken breast
hummus (roasted red pepper has best flavor for this)
ww tortillas
chopped tomatoes
chopped red onion
shredded cheese
I make this at least once a week, sometimes twice.
Bake a chicken breast or two in salsa, or cook however you want with some Mexican-y spices.
Then chop cooked chicken into small pieces (I usually make 2-3 at time so I have the fixins ready for another night).
Take a tortilla and spread it with hummus. Pile chopped chicken, tomatoes, red onion and shredded cheese on top. Bake for 10-15 minutes at 375ish (until toasty brown on top and edges are crisp). It ends up being like a messy healthy pizza. You can vary the ingredients- sometimes I add beans if I have them, chopped cilantro or avocado, etc.

Love this and B does too. He stopped liking eggs so we tried this recipe that we normally have Christmas morning. Now we make a pan and freeze the squares individually.**
10 eggs
1/2 c flour, sifted
1 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p salt
16 oz small curd cottage cheese
1 lb shredded jack cheese (cheddar is yummy too)
1/2 c butter, melted
2 cans (4oz each) diced green chiles
Preheat oven to 350. Beat eggs, add flour, baking powder, salt, cottage and jack cheese, butter and blend until smooth. Stir in chiles. Butter a 9x13" baking pan and pour mixture in. Bake for 35 mins or until golden brown on top.
**We can take one square right out of the freezer in the morning and nuke on 50% power for 1 1/2 mins, flip and do another 1-1 1/2 mins. Good with fruit.

Willman's fried meatballs
Ground beef
Ground pork
1 shredded carrot
1/2 bag of spinach, cooked and chopped
Worcestershire sauce
Garlic, Parsley, oregano, and pepper
1 egg
Parm cheese
Plain bread crumbs
Smush all in a bowl, roll into balls, and fry in 1/4 in sunflower oil for about 8 minutes, turning them to brown on all sides.
The best thing is you can make all the balls and freeze what you don't make. Just go from frozen to the pan for a quick meal.
